1.A certain code consists of 5 variables,with each variable having 4 different constant values possible.What is the total number of coded messages that can be sent with 5 constants one from each variable?
2Akshay is planning to give a birthday party at his place.In how many ways can he invite one or more of five friends and seat them at a circular table?Also in how many ways can he invite one or more of his five friends and seat them at a circular table with him?
3.How many ways are there to pick two different cards from a deck of 52 cards such that the first card is a spade and the second is not a queen?
4.There are 8 different locks,with exactly one key for each lock.All the keys have been mixed up.What is the maximum number of trials required in order to detremine which key belongs to which lock?
5.The total number of ways in which six "+" and four "-" signs can be arranged in a line such that no two "-" signs occur together?
6.Let A be the set of 4 digit numbers a1,a2,a3,a4 where a1>a2>a3>a4 then how many values of A are possible?
7.The total number of selections of atmost "n" things from "2n+1" different things is 63.What is the value of "n"?
8.The total number of integral solutions for (x,y,z) such that xyz=24 is?
9.The number of positive integral solutions of x+y+z = n,n E N,n>=3 is ?
10.There are 20 questions in a qn paper.If no two students solve the same combination of qns but solve equal number of qns,then the maximum number of students who appeared in the exam is ?
11.In how many ways can 15 isc and 13 bsc students be arranged in a line so that no two bsc students may occupy consecutive positions is?
12.How many numbers greater than 4 millions can be formed with the digits 2,3,0,4,3,2,5?
13.How many signals can be made by hoisting 2 blue, 2 red and 5 black flags on a pole at the same time?
14.In how many ways can 12 different books be distributed equally among 4 persons?
15.Find the sum of all the four digit numbers that can be formed with the digits 3,2,3,4?
16.The sides of a triangle have 3,4,5 interior points respectively on them .Find the number of triangles that can be constructed using given interior points as vertices?
17.Let S be the set of five-digit numbers formed by digits 1,2,3,,4 and 5 using each digit exactly once such that exactly 2 odd positions are occupied by odd digits.What is the sum of the digits in the rightmost position of the numbers in S?
18.A person wishes to throw as many different parties as he can out of his 20 friends such that each party consists of the same number of persons.The number of friends he should invite at a time is?
